Joseph C Apostol, M.D.

According to 2025 Medicare claims, Joseph Apostol, M.D. (NPI: 1497781512) practices cardiology in the Billings, MT market, with the plurality of this provider's patient population coming from Yellowstone, MT. This provider's primary affiliated billing organization is SCL HEALTH MEDICAL GROUP - BILLINGS LLC (NPI: 1508289703; TIN: 464056262) and primary practice location at 59101-7502. Apostol is affiliated with the Rocky Mountain Accountable Health Network, Inc (ACO ID: A2217), Caravan Health ACO 50 LLC (ACO ID: A5160), Collaborative ACO 30, LLC (ACO ID: A5483), and CoreHealth Alliance LLC (ACO ID: A5645), participating under the MSSP model.

Apostol's data goes back to 2015 and runs through 2024. For example, in 2024, this provider had 1,077 traditional Medicare patients, billed 4,483 HCPCS/CPT codes, and received $258,433 in Medicare payments. The top billing code was 93306 (Ultrasound of heart with color-depicted blood flow, rate, direction and valve function). Part D data shows 4,487 prescription claims across 668 beneficiaries totaling $1,040,366 in drug costs, led by Eliquis (Apixaban). DME data shows 95 claims. Over the past 10 years, this provider's Medicare Part B carrier billing did not follow a clear longitudinal pattern. Concurrently, Part D prescription costs have moved sharply higher in recent years, from $186,883 to $1,040,366. In contrast, DME billing represents a smaller volume and started with an early spike, then settled into a lower baseline, moving from $40,862 to $10,905.
